What brand is the Edge's 8AT transmission?

The Edge's 8AT transmission is Ford's own brand, model 8F35. An automatic transmission is a gear-shifting device that can automatically change gears based on the vehicle's speed and engine RPM, as opposed to a manual transmission. Currently, there are four common types of automatic transmissions in vehicles: hydraulic automatic transmission (AT), continuously variable transmission (CVT), automated manual transmission (AMT), and dual-clutch transmission (DCT). The Edge is a compact SUV under Changan Ford. Taking the Edge 2020 EcoBoost245 two-wheel-drive Enjoy model as an example, its dimensions are 4585mm in length, 1882mm in width, and 1688mm in height, with a wheelbase of 2710mm. The body adopts a 5-door, 5-seat structure, with a fuel tank capacity of 63 liters and a curb weight of 1585kg.

Where to Apply for Temporary License Plates?

Obtaining official license plates for a vehicle takes some time. During this period, if the driver wishes to drive on the road, they can apply for temporary license plates at the vehicle management office. Below is relevant information on applying for temporary license plates: 1. Preparation of Materials: Original and photocopy of the vehicle certificate (imported vehicles require import documentation); Original and photocopy of the third copy of compulsory traffic insurance; Original and photocopy of the owner's identity proof; If applying through a representative, the original and photocopy of the representative's ID card are required. 2. Types of Temporary License Plates: Temporary plates within administrative jurisdictions, temporary plates across administrative jurisdictions, temporary plates for test vehicles, and temporary plates for special vehicles.

What to Do When a Car Blocks You Without Leaving a Phone Number?

If your car is blocked by another vehicle without a phone number left, you can try the following methods: 1. Call 122: A reliable method is to dial 12122. Provide the license plate number, and 122 will directly notify the traffic police in the owner's district, who will then contact the owner. 2. Call 110: If you confirm that the other party is parked illegally, you can call 110 to request a tow truck. However, this method can cause significant inconvenience to the other party, so it is recommended to use it only as a last resort. 3. Call 114: Some car owners do not leave their phone numbers to protect their privacy, but they may have registered a moving vehicle number on platforms like 114. You can contact the owner to move the car by calling 114.

What Are the Consequences of Keeping the Motorcycle Choke Open for a Long Time?

Keeping the motorcycle choke open for a long time can cause the engine to stall automatically and severely damage the spark plug. Here is additional information: 1. Function of the choke: It adjusts the air-fuel mixture ratio. Normally, a certain proportion of gasoline mixed with a specific amount of air is sufficient for riding. In cold weather, combustion becomes more difficult, so the proportion of gasoline in the air needs to be increased to facilitate engine startup. Once the engine is running, the mixture can return to the normal ratio, i.e., by opening the choke. 2. Choke positions: The motorcycle's choke has three positions—upper, middle, and lower. During startup, move it to the uppermost position. After warming up and during normal riding, move it to the lowermost position. The middle position is generally used as a transition during warm-up and is rarely or seldom used.

Why Shouldn't Cars Be Submerged in Water?

The hazards of a submerged car are as follows: 1. Hidden dangers: 'Flood-damaged cars' can be repaired to a certain extent, but even after repair, serious hidden dangers remain. The longer the immersion time, the higher the probability of malfunctions. This is similar to a watch falling into water; even if it's disassembled and dried, the watch will still malfunction and cannot be completely repaired. Additionally, flood-damaged cars often have sand and gravel that cannot be completely cleaned out, remaining in areas like gears or belts, leading to easier damage of certain parts and initial abnormal noises. Generally, repairing a water-submerged vehicle involves first removing the seats, interior components, and panels, draining the accumulated water, and cleaning the mud. The engine also needs to be disassembled to check electronic components, especially whether the computer motherboard is damaged. 2. Potential problems may arise at any time: In reality, a 'flood-damaged car' after repair is like a 'time bomb,' with problems potentially arising at any moment, such as the engine suddenly stalling during high-speed driving, airbags failing to deploy in critical moments or deploying without reason. Although such cars are cheap, they pose serious safety hazards during daily driving, so consumers are advised not to purchase 'flood-damaged cars' just to save money. 3. The longer the time, the more severe the damage: The longer a vehicle is submerged in water, the more components will be severely damaged due to water immersion. This can cause corrosion of internal metal parts in some of the car's computer boards, leading to poor contact, unstable operation, and other phenomena. During driving, issues like shaking and stalling may occur, and in severe cases, the computer board may short-circuit and burn out.

What transmission does the Bestune T77 use?

Bestune T77 is equipped with a 6-speed manual transmission and a 7-speed dual-clutch transmission, all models are powered by a 1.2T engine with a maximum output power of 105 kW, a maximum torque of 204 Nm, and a top speed of 181 km/h. The front face design of the Bestune T77 looks quite aggressive, featuring numerous geometric lines. The grille area adopts a dot-matrix design with a strong three-dimensional effect inside. The headlights are relatively narrow and long, giving a highly aggressive and recognizable appearance. The body dimensions of the Bestune T77 are 4525mm in length, 1845mm in width, and 1615mm in height, with a wheelbase of 2700mm.

What are the penalties for an expired temporary license plate?

Temporary license plate expiration will result in fines and demerit points. The following are the penalty regulations for expired temporary license plates: 1. Vehicle impoundment: If the temporary plate has expired and a new one has not been processed, the vehicle should be parked at home and not driven until the new temporary plate is obtained. Driving with an expired temporary plate, if caught, will result in the vehicle being impounded. An expired temporary plate is considered invalid and equivalent to driving without a license plate, which will be severely penalized if caught on the road. 2. Fine of 200 yuan: According to the "Road Traffic Law," driving with an expired temporary license plate, if caught, will result in a fine of 200 yuan. 3. Deduction of 12 points: The driving license has a total of 12 points, and driving with an expired temporary license plate, if caught, will result in an immediate deduction of 12 points.
